1. Prionacalus atys White, 1850 View in CoL

Type locality — Peru , Andes. ( BMNH). Distribution — Ecuador, Peru .

Prionacalus Atys White, 1850: 11 View in CoL , pl. 13, fig. 14.

Prionocalus Atys ; Waterhouse, 1872: 261; Thomson, 1877: 260.

Psalidognathus (Prionocalus) atys View in CoL ; Lameere, 1910b: 377; Duffy, 1960: 69 (larva).

Prionocalus atys View in CoL ; Huedepohl, 1985: 121.
